dotfiles

My macOS dotfiles, with the ability to choose from two shells:

  • Bash (.bash_profile and .bash_prompt)
  • Zsh (.zshrc)

Both shells use .functions file, where some useful functions and aliases are stored.
The init folder contains default Visual Studio Code and iTerm2 settings.
.hushlogin is only used in shells to avoid last login information prompts.

New setup

If setting up a new mac, run bootstrap.sh, which installs Xcode command-line tools and Homebrew and executes sequentially:

  1. brew.sh, to install command-line tools
  2. python.sh, to install useful Python pip packages
  3. brew_cask.sh, to install main applications
  4. .macos, to configure system and default apps settings

Note: bootstrap.sh requires you to login to the Mac App Store and manually install Xcode.app, before being called.
